The Importance of Timing and Prediction
Success in this chicken-crossing adventure isn’t purely about reacting to what’s immediately in front of you. While swift reflexes are crucial, anticipating the movement of vehicles is paramount. Players must learn to judge the speed of approaching cars and identify gaps in traffic patterns. A successful player isn’t merely reacting; they’re proactively planning their chicken’s route several steps ahead. This predictive element adds a layer of depth that elevates the game beyond a simple reflex test. Observing how different vehicles behave is also key – some may maintain a consistent speed, while others might accelerate or decelerate, demanding adaptable strategies. Mastering these nuances separates casual players from those striving for high scores.
Developing a Strategic Mindset
Many players initially approach the game by frantically clicking to move the chicken forward. However, a more measured and thoughtful approach will yield far greater results. Pausing briefly to assess the situation before making a move can dramatically increase survival rates. Consider the position of multiple vehicles simultaneously, and identify the safest window of opportunity. Don’t be afraid to wait for the perfect moment; a few seconds of patience can prevent a disastrous collision. Furthermore, focusing on consistent, small movements, rather than large leaps, provides greater control and reduces the risk of misjudging distances. The focus isn’t simply to get across, but to get across efficiently and safely.

Variations and Adaptations of the Core Concept
While the basic premise of a chicken crossing a road remains consistent, many variations exist. Some versions introduce obstacles like moving platforms, changing lane configurations, or even different types of vehicles with unique behaviors. Others incorporate power-ups that grant temporary invincibility, speed boosts, or the ability to slow down time. These adaptations add a welcome layer of complexity and keep the gameplay from becoming stale. Each variation presents new challenges and requires players to adapt their strategies accordingly. The core mechanic of risk assessment and precise timing remains central, but the specific challenges evolve, ensuring a continuously engaging experience.
